Download: “Heaven And Hell Are NOT Confirmed”
Download Festival Organizer Andy Copping has said that, contrary to the band’s announcement, Heaven And Hell are not yet confirmed to be playing Download. Speaking to Classic Rock, Copping said: “They are not confirmed and they’ve never been confirmed for the festival,” said Copping. “No, they’re absolutely not (confirmed). I’m not saying that they’re not playing, I’m just saying that they’ve not been confirmed.” Classic Rock recently sat down to hear tracks from Heaven And Hell’s forthcoming new album and you can read our verdict.
